I tried this for cleaning super messy basement and with my kids (11 and 16) for cleaning their extremely messy rooms and it worked well. A lot of the problem was trying to sort through things while in the messy room felt too overwhelming, but this really helped. This is similar to what other people have suggested but a bit different.

Get a separate area of the house to be your staging area (could be the hallway outside your room, spare room, whatever). Set up a trash bag/can, a laundry hamper, and a large plastic storage tote (or sturdy box). Get a second tote/box to bring to your room. In your room, clear obvious trash on surfaces first, remove any larger items that are in the way of getting to smaller items, then pick a spot to start and just load up the tote with handful/armloads of stuff until it’s full.

Bring the tote to your staging area and go through it. Trash goes in the trash, laundry in the hamper, anything that goes back to your room goes into the other tote. Anything like dishes or things belonging elsewhere in the house can be brought there right away. Then go back and fill the tote again.

Repeat until you have the room cleared. Then vacuum/clean then reorganize the stuff you want back in your room.

Tapering from 225mg to 37.5mg (provided you drop down every few weeks which it sounds like you are doing) is not too bad for most people. Going from 37.5mg to 0mg is where you will have the most trouble. You may need to stretch out the amount of time you are on the lowest dose (took me 2 months) and you might need to start taking them every second day or taking granules out of the capsules and taking less than the full amount. I ended up taking a small amount of granules every few days at the very end of my taper to make the brain zaps stop. If you are going to switch to another med, cross tapering them might help though (once you get to the 37.5mg of Effexor, start taking the lowest dose of your new med at the same time - if your doctor says that’s ok, of course). You haven’t been on Effexor for a super long time, so you might not have as much trouble as a lot of people do. And everyone is different. It’s certainly not fun but slowly tapering will make it tolerable.
